Hereford Train Station is equipped with a range of facilities to enhance your journey. The ticket office, open from 05:15 to 18:40 on weekdays and 09:15 to 18:40 on Sundays, ensures ample time for travelers to secure their tickets. Plus, there are ticket machines available, which are accessible during these hours and accept cash, debit, and credit cards.
Accessibility is a priority here, with step-free access throughout the station. Platforms are connected by a footbridge with lifts, ensuring all travelers, including those with limited mobility, can navigate with ease. Toilets, including accessible ones and baby changing facilities, are located on Platform 3, and the entire station is under CCTV surveillance for added security.
For those needing assistance or further information, staff is present from 06:15 to 21:00, and help points are scattered around the station. And while Hereford lacks facilities like cycle hire or shops, it does offer a welcoming café for refreshments.
Connecting with other transport modes is a breeze at Hereford Station. For instance, the taxi rank is conveniently located in the station car park. If your journey requires a rail replacement service, the bus stop is right in front of the station. However, it's worth noting that although cycle hire facilities are not available, ample bicycle storage is present, accommodating up to 50 bikes.

The station is well-equipped with essential facilities aimed at ensuring a comfortable journey. Even though there are no ticket machines on-site, tickets can be collected from the ticket office, which is staffed with friendly personnel ready to offer help. For those relying on smartcards, you'll be pleased to know that Conway Park can issue and validate smartcards, making it easier for regular commuters.
Accessibility features prominently with step-free access across all platforms and ramps available for train access, making it an inclusive choice for everyone. Although there aren’t accessible ticket machines or toilets currently available, the staff is always on hand to assist during hours of operation.
Avid explorers and busy commuters will be pleased by Conway Park's connectivity to numerous travel options. While the station does not feature an on-site taxi rank, it provides proximity to Europa Boulevard for rail replacement services when needed. For access to buses and further onward travel, Merseytravel's website offers comprehensive information.
Conveniently, tickets to Liverpool John Lennon Airport can be purchased directly through Merseyrail stations, simplifying your onward journey. Did you know a quick bus ride from Liverpool South Parkway station can get you to the airport in just 10 minutes?
